Ripped off by yet another buyer! Ebay's Buyer Wins no matter what policy.

esell-resell
Thrill-Seeker

Has this happenned to anyone else?



I sold a Computer Server to a buyer on Ebay, this guy phoned me, we discussed everything about the server and shipping. Now this guy was cheap I could tell just by him whinning about how much the shipping would be and how long it would take.



So me being a nice person and I know what it is like to have to wait and wait for my package, I told him to send me $90 and I would express ship it out to him and he would have it in 3 - 4 days. He agreed and sent me the extra $90 plus I gave him a deal on the server $169.99 , when I could have easily got $200. The server weighs 70lbs and is 26"longX19"highX9"wide and has to be shipped in it's proper sitting place so I had to label it with THIS SIDE UP stickers and also HEAVY stickers (70lbs) and alot of FRAGILE AND HANDLE WITH CARE stickers. It cost me $280.00 to ship it to him (no lie I have the receipt from UPS on my account) and only charged him $90. When I packaged the server I did it at the UPS office that I go to all the time and the UPS agent helped me actually. I wrapped it in packing cardboard and used a bubble packing envelope for extra cushion on the back of the tower server so that none of the conections would be broken. It was then triple wrapped with cardboard boxes customly made top fit tight around the server and several layers of red Tuck Tape were used to seal it all up.



The buyer received it I believe 6 days later because some of the paperwork for the border ( Canada to USA) were not proper so it took a few more days. When his even NORMAL shipping, like the cheapest from Winnipeg Manitoba Canada to New York USA would have been $133.00 and would have taken 2 - 3 weeks to get there. Remember he only paid $90?



Anyway 3 days after he received the server he sends me a message that it was damaged during shipping because it was not packaged properly and he wants all his money back and also the shipping money. In my listing I had listed no returns or exchanges. I want all of you to know that I have sold many of these units and I always, ALWAYS run a system check on them before shipping them out and I have never had a problem. So I replied to him that I most certainly did package it properly and I asked him to send me pictures please and I also asked him why he would accept a package that was damaged. He would not respond or nor did he send any pictures.



Yesterday I received a buyer complaint thing from Ebay and Paypal puts a $179.99 hold on my account. I responded to the complaint and explained everything in detail and informed the buyer that I would be contacting Ebay and UPS this morning.



This morning I woke up a little later than usual 11am and noticed that the buyer had already escalated the complaint with Ebay at 6am. I immediately phoned Ebay and spoke to someone in the Ebay Buyer Protection department and I explained everything to the rep and also that I packed it in front of the UPS agent who helped me and that the buyer would not send me any pictures, and I expressed to the rep that I think what the buyer did was buy a different server locally because I noticed on his account that a few days after he bought my server, he was buying Tape drives for a completely different server, and after speaking with him on the phone he had said that he was in need of a server badly because they did not have one.



So here is what the Ebay rep did during the phone call I had with him. He ruled in the buyers favor and now the buyer can take 7 - 14 days to ship it to me and he can send it anyway he wants, so I will be waiting for 4- 6 weeks at the very least to get back a BROKEN server that has now cost me 280.00$ in shipping and is probably now worth nothing because here is what I believe happenned the buyer found a server locally and then read the buyer protection policy and then damaged the server ON PURPOSE then filed the claim. I know I cannot prove it 100% but I know that is what happenned.



So now I am out over $550.00 and apparently there is nothing I can do about it. I am sooo tired of getting ripped off on Ebay by buyers that LIE and Ebay rules in there favor all the time. I have 2 kids and this is christmas time and this extra money is for gifts for them, I am so UPSET right now with Ebay that I am about ready to quit selling on here completely.



I go out of my way to ENSURE that items are packed EXTRA well so that damage does not happen, and now I get ripped off by some goon that uses the policy to get away with it.




BEWARE SELLERS this can happen to you.



I think Ebay needs to wake up and change some of this NON-SENSE policy loop holes that these scammers use to scam you out of money. Oh and get this that buyer can now leave me NEGATIVE feedback but I cannot do the same to him, I can either leave positive or no feedback!



UNBELIEVABLE!!!!



Has anyone else had this happen to them?

Ebay is using the feedback system to screw honest sellers.  Even if a buyer gives you a positive - they have the option as most sellers know (because we are often also buyers) - to rate, shipping, item as described, etc;, with a five star system.  The problem is - if they buy and item and it's 100% perfect and shipped fast - the buyer can click a low star rating by accident or on purpose for any reason (even if they had a bad hair day) - and cause you as a seller to suddenly become a below standard seller.  It does not matter if you have a 100% rating and have been dealing with the common rip off artists searching Ebay items for a five finger discount - EBAY WILL allow buyers to damage your business by degrading your rating behind the scenes where you have no idea what hit you or any recourse.  Ebay treats buyers like we work for them and anytime a buyer wants to rip us off - we should just shut up and take it with a smile!  Problem is that Ebay forgets it's place; we are paying for a service (per the FTC) and they work for us.  Unless a seller is doing something wrong - Ebay should be working with sellers under the implied contract we hold with them to sell our goods; to protect sellers from these kind of ridiculous ratings, "a star system"!  If a buyer is unhappy or a seller made a mistake in a listing - honest sellers work with a buyer, but Ebay does not honor this kind of practice they punish sellers; "low standard" for subjective stars - equals higher fees, no free listings, and less exposure of your goods.  If a seller is really doing something wrong - bravo for Ebay doing something right - but when a seller does everything right - this is like saying everytime a buyer at Walmart returns an item because the color does not exactly match their eyes - that Walmart should reduce the pay of their workers and allow less customers in the store!  Wake up Ebay - good sellers also shop on Ebay and will be looking to take their purchasing power somewhere else.
